- Trading stalls amid Ganesh Chaturthi
- Buyers adopt wait-and-watch stance
India’s induction furnace (IF) steel market experienced a slowdown due to the Ganesh Chaturthi festival, with mills’ offers fluctuating by INR 50-500/tonne (t) d-o-d on 27 August 2025.
Sponge iron offers increased by INR 50-150/t d-o-d, with the steepest hike of INR 150/t in Raigarh.
Billet tags varied by INR 50-200/t across locations.
Rebar (Fe 500) offers fluctuated by INR 100-500/t d-o-d. In Hyderabad, prices fell by INR 500/t. However, prices edged up by INR 300/t in Raigarh.
Today, trading activity was muted. Major markets were closed due to Ganesh Chaturthi, and buyers showed less interest in procuring material and adopted a wait-and-watch stance. Overall, prices are likely to remain range-bound in the short term.
The conversion spread from sponge iron (PDRI) to billets for standalone induction furnaces in the Raipur cluster was assessed at INR 13,650/t.
